1st off it seems as you are no longer able to buy MIL eliminators,So if staying legal is important you might wanna give that some thought,your only others options would be to buy a turner to turn them off or look on the net...there are write ups on making your own MIL's and looks pretty simpe to do to me.

2nd the tri ax is awesome,worth the money but....I think I would go for option 1 or 2 first.Maybe option 2 since you have the springs,but option one would be nice for some more sound.

Sorry cant help you with the rims,personally I dont like vette rims,and really wouldnt like them on a stang....but thats just me.
 
If you are gonna get an OR h-pipe id save more and get a tuner so 1: you can take advantage of the flow 2: turn off the MIL

Also IMO the MGW is by far the best shifter. Everyone that I know with a Stang thats driven mine absolutly loves the MGW. The Termi has a Tri Ax in it and is getting replaced with a MGW next month too :nice:
